D-4 SECOND READING OF AN ORDINANCE AMENDING TITLE 8 (BUILDING\nREGULATIONS) OF THE LA PUENTE MUNICIPAL CODE ADDING CHAPTER 8.50\nSETTING FORTH PROCEDURES FOR AN EXPEDITED PERMIT PROCESS FOR\nELECTRIC VEHICLE CHARGING SYSTEMS AND ADOPTION OF A RESOLUTION\nFOR AN APPLICATION CHECKLIST FOR THE EXPEDITED PERMIT PROCESS FOR\nELECTRIC VEHICLE CHARGING SYSTEMS\nIt is recommended that the City Council: (1) adopt Ordinance No. 23-983, an ordinance of\nthe City Council of the City of La Puente amending Title 8 (Building Regulations) of the La\nPuente Municipal Code adding Chapter 8.50 setting forth procedures for an expedited permit\nprocess for Electric Vehicle Charging Systems; and (2) adopt Resolution No. 23-5829 for an\napplication checklist for the expedited permit process for electric vehicle charging systems.\nD-4 EV Charging Ordinance 2nd Reading Staff Report\nD-4 EV Charging Ordinance 2nd Reading Attachment A Ordinance\nD-4 EV Charging Ordinance 2nd Reading Attachment B Resolution

D-5 CONSIDERATION OF A RESOLUTION RESCINDING RESOLUTION NO. 23-5813\nAND AMENDING THE COMPREHENSIVE PERSONNEL SYSTEM FOR FULL-TIME\nPOSITIONS TO ADD A FULL-TIME CHIEF/DIRECTOR OF PUBLIC SAFETY\nIt is recommended that the City Council: (1) adopt Resolution No. 23-5834 rescinding\nresolution No. 23-5813 amending the comprehensive personnel system; (2) approve the job\ndescription for the full-time Chief/ Director of Public Safety position; and (3) provide any\nnecessary direction to Staff.\nD-5 Full-Time Chief-Director of Public Safety Staff Report\nD-5 Full-Time Chief-Director of Public Safety Attachment A Resolution\nD-5 Full-Time Chief-Director of Public Safety Attachment B Job Description

E-2 DISCUSSION AND DIRECTION REGARDING A CONCEPTUAL DESIGN FOR A DOG\nPARK/ANIMAL SHELTER AND CONSIDERATION OF CONTRACT WITH TAP\nQUALIFIED ARCHITECURAL CONTRACTOR UTILIZING MEASURE A FUNDING IN\nAN AMOUNT NOT TO EXCEED $90,000\nIt is recommended that the City Council: (1) discuss this item and provide direction to Staff\nof the proposed location for the City Dog Park and Animal Shelter; and (2) authorize the City\nManager to select an Architect from TAP's list of qualified consultants and enter into a\ncontract for up to $90,000.00 to produce formal design options for the Dog Park and Animal\nShelter.\nE-2 Dog Park Animal Shelter Staff Report\nE-2 Dog Park Animal Shelter Attachment A TAP Qualified Consultants\nE-2 Dog Park Animal Shelter Attachment B Conceptual Draft
